FPX Transaction definition

FPX Transaction means the successful payment of any of FPX Merchant via FPX. The minimum FPX Transaction for retail payment (B2C) and for corporate payment (B2B) is RM10. The FPX Transaction is to be carried out during the Promotion Period through any preferred Internet or Mobile Banking of the Participating Banks.
